- Noun Examples
- the act of vibrating
- a shaky motion;
"the shaking of his fingers as he lit his pipe"
- Adjective Satellite Examples
- vibrating slightly and irregularly;
as e.g. with fear or cold or like the leaves of an aspen in a breeze;
"a quaking bog";
"the quaking child asked for more";
"quivering leaves of a poplar tree";
"with shaking knees";
"seemed shaky on her feet";
